I recently did business with VIDEO PROFESSOR. They advertised a free training disk for the price of $6.95 shipping and handling. When I received the product there were 3 disks and a note stating I could keep them all for a charge of $79.95 or return one disk and there would be no charge. I immediately called them and after many calls where they left me waiting and then cutting me off I was able to receive a return code. The disk and a letter with all of my information was returned to them well before before there cut off date.

Much to my surprise, on their cut off date, VIDEO PROFESSOR charged my account the $79.95. When I spoke to them they stated they hadn't received the disk back!!!' they told me it might have been lost in the mail being that we were in the holidays heavy mail season. Upon my protest I was told she cannot do anything about it, the problem must be passed onto the accounting department and they do not have phone access!!!

VIDEO PROFESSOR is falsely advertising their product as 'a free trial disk, for only a $6.95 shipping and handling fee' BE WARE.
